Sarah Street
2014
In 2014, Sarah Street earned a total compensation of $3.7M as Executive Vice President, Chief Investment Officer at XL Group, a 1% increase compared to previous year.
Compensation breakdown
Non-Equity Incentive Plan | $1,698,700 |
---|---|
Option Awards | $675,005 |
Salary | $500,000 |
Stock Awards | $634,368 |
Other | $232,094 |
Total | $3,740,167 |
Street received $1.7M in non-equity incentive plan, accounting for 45% of the total pay in 2014.
Street also received $675K in option awards, $500K in salary, $634.4K in stock awards and $232.1K in other compensation.
